The NASCAR Cup Series is ready to take on the 2026 Jack Link's 500 at Talladega Superspeedway, and the entry list has been revealed.
NASCAR released the 2026 Jack Link's 500 and O'Reilly Series entry list for Talladega on Monday afternoon. Talladega is the first superspeedway track since EchoPark Speedway in late February, but it won't feature the Truck Series. The NASCAR level has an off-weekend.
All 36 full-time drivers are present for the 2026 Jack Link's 500 on Sunday afternoon. This is the second season in the charter system's history in which all 36 entries have a full-time competitor. Jesse Love (Richard Childress Racing), Joey Gase (NY Racing Team), Casey Mears (Beard Motorsports), Chad Finchum (Garage 66), and Daniel Dye (Live Fast Motorsports) are the open entries, making it a 41-driver field. One driver will miss the show.
